Penne with meatballs in vegetables

Preparation time: 20 minutes
Cooking time: 30 minutes
Total time: 50 minutes
Number of servings: 4

Ingredients

For the meatballs:
- 500 g minced chicken (you can also use pork or beef if you prefer)
- 2 large onions, finely chopped
- 2 garlic cloves, crushed
- 2 tablespoons breadcrumbs (for a crunchier texture, you can use homemade breadcrumbs)
- Spices: 1 teaspoon thyme, salt and pepper to taste

For the vegetable garnish:
- 1 can of peeled tomatoes (about 400 g)
- 2 onions, chopped
- 2 bell peppers, diced
- 1 green bell pepper, diced
- 1 zucchini, sliced
- 1 bunch of parsley, chopped
- 1 bunch of dill, chopped
- Olive oil for sautéing
- Spices: salt, pepper, oregano, basil to taste

For the pasta garnish:
- 500 g shells or penne from Barilla (or other preferred pasta)

Step by step: How to prepare penne with meatballs in vegetables

Step 1: Preparing the meatballs

1. Mix the 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the minced chicken, chopped onion, crushed garlic, breadcrumbs, and spices. Mix well until you achieve a homogeneous composition.

2. Form the meatballs: With wet hands, shape small meatballs from the obtained mixture. Make sure they are of equal size so they cook evenly.

3. Dredging in breadcrumbs: Roll each meatball in breadcrumbs for a crispy and golden crust.

Step 2: Boil the meatballs

1. Boiling: In a large pot, bring water to a boil. Add peppercorns, bay leaves, and a pinch of salt to flavor the water. When the water starts to boil, add the meatballs and let them boil for 10-15 minutes, until they rise to the surface.

Step 3: Preparing the pasta

1. Boiling the pasta: In another pot, add salted water and bring to a boil. Add the shell or penne pasta and cook according to the package instructions, usually between 8-12 minutes. Make sure they are al dente, as they will continue to cook in the oven.

Step 4: Preparing the vegetables

1. Sautéing the vegetables: In a large skillet, add a little olive oil and sauté the onion along with the bell peppers until they become soft.

2. Adding zucchini and tomatoes: After a few minutes, add the zucchini and peeled tomatoes. Cook until the vegetables are tender, about 10-12 minutes.

3. Seasoning: Finally, add the parsley, dill, and your preferred spices (salt, pepper, oregano, basil). Mix well to integrate the flavors.

Step 5: Baking and serving

1. Assembly: Preheat the oven to 180°C. In a baking dish, combine the boiled meatballs with the sautéed vegetables. Mix to evenly distribute the ingredients.

2. Baking: Bake for 15-20 minutes, until the meatballs are slightly browned.

3. Serving: Serve the mixture of meatballs with vegetables alongside the boiled pasta. You can add a drizzle of olive oil and a sprinkle of grated parmesan for extra flavor.

Practical tips

- Vegetarian option: If you want a meat-free option, you can replace the chicken with a mix of finely chopped vegetables (carrots, mushrooms, eggplant) and quinoa or rice. Add an egg to bind the ingredients.

- Step by step for vegans: A vegan alternative for the meatballs can include ground nuts, tofu, or boiled lentils, mixed with spices and breadcrumbs.

- Additional garnishes: You can add feta cheese or mozzarella at the end for a richer and creamier taste.

- Recommended drinks: This meal pairs perfectly with a glass of dry white wine or an aromatic herbal tea, which will complement the flavors of the main dish.

Frequently asked questions

- What type of meat can I use for the meatballs? You can experiment with pork, beef, or even turkey, depending on your preferences.

- Can I use seasonal vegetables? Absolutely! Use the vegetables you have on hand or seasonal ones to vary the recipe.

- How can I store leftovers? You can store leftovers in the refrigerator, in an airtight container, for 2-3 days. You can reheat in the oven or microwave.
